Transaction 58167874f58e6c938cd8d0aa896fbe8be2d8c17f5a2c6a76768408b20a741986

10 Input
2 Outputs
  • 58167874f58e6c938cd8d0aa896fbe8be2d8c17f5a2c6a76768408b20a741986:0
  • value  15000000000
    address  3PfBZHXPYFX9dAEEhznb3i37WNCKjtkh9X
  • 58167874f58e6c938cd8d0aa896fbe8be2d8c17f5a2c6a76768408b20a741986:1
  • value  2278264587
    address  39E9usauMZiE3po4M8jMH2RSbBrbGYjbtQ